Make sure the motherboard has adequate slots for any cards you plan to install and adequate spacing, as many cards are wide and overlap the next slot. Motherboards include onboard audio features, but most DAW users have their own audio interface to install in a card slot, or connect via USB or FireWire. So don’t be swayed by advanced on-board audio features unless you need them. I usually end up disabling the onboard audio anyway, in the process of eliminating potential conflicts with my own audio interface and software. Motherboards often come with utility applications that can be loaded to your hard drive. Utilities can be very useful. But some utilities are made for power management or overclocking, or are otherwise intrusive. Motherboard utilities can interfere with DAW operation. So it’s best to tell your builder not to load any utility software, at least until you can evaluate it. Video Card (ASUS nVidia GeForce GT210 with 1 GB VRAM): For video cards, I like to keep it simple and stay with an inexpensive, major-brand, general-purpose card. A silent video card (ie. no fan on board) is typically less powerful but easily sufficient for DAW work, and nicely quiet and cool. If you’re running multiple displays, make sure the card supports the type and number of displays you want to attach. Be aware that many video cards now include an HDMI connection, which means another audio device sneaking into your DAW PC. I would change BIOS settings and Device Manager to disable this high-definition audio driver to prevent DAW interference. RAM (Super Talent DDR3-1333 MHz 12 GB [3 modules @ 4 GB each] Triple Channel): RAM speeds continue to climb, but you may have to “over-clock” your RAM to achieve that speed, depending on what speed your motherboard supports. The Gigabyte motherboard defaults to 1066 MHz. However, I’m currently doing fine running the RAM at the 1333 MHz speed, which is not a big leap up from 1066. But be aware that overclocking means running components faster than manufacturer specs, which could be risky to DAW operation. The reason I installed three modules is to take advantage of triple-channel architecture. With three modules in three slots, the RAM modules are accessed in an alternating pattern, increasing the RAM bandwidth/performance as opposed to using one or two RAM modules. Hard drives (Samsung SpinPoint F3 SATA2 7200 RPM, 1 TB size): When it comes to hard drives, look for high reliability, and speeds of at least 7200 RPM. Most DAW vendors recommend at least three drives, so you can keep your programs, project files, and sample files on separate drives, for the best throughput when your DAW is accessing all three types of files concurrently. That’s what I did. The latest trend in hard drives is Solid State. Solid State Drives (SSD) store everything on a memory chip. With no moving parts, they are fast and reliable, and offer great potential for DAW performance. But they are significantly more expensive per GB than a traditional hard drive. Power supply (Seasonic S12 SS-650HT, Energy+ 650W SLI EPS): A power supply needs to be quiet, reliable, and provide ample power for your PC today plus any expansion you may do in the future. Typical DAWs recommend at least 500 watts or more. PC Case (Cooler Master Centurion 590 Mid-Tower): Use a mid-size or large-size case—avoid the smaller ones. The bigger cases have better airflow, room to expand, and room to move around in there as needed. Thanks to a blue LED fan in front, the Centurion gives off just a touch of ‘gamer glow’ and manages a hip appearance while still looking classy enough for your next session with Céline. Some cases allow for the use of larger fans. Larger fans are typically less noisy than smaller fans, and also provide for better cooling.

Case Fans (Antec TriCool 120mm Case Fan with 3Spd Switch 120MM): The TriCool fan has a 3-position variable-speed control, which allows you to tune the speed of each fan, and thereby the noise level as well. Go for the slowest/quietest speed on each fan that still keeps the PC cool. Should you ever run into heat problems, you’ll still have some “fan headroom” available to bump up the speed and keep the system cooler. Burn-in and delivery It took just under a week for the shop to build the new PC, including their two-day burn-in period to check it out. Then I added my existing Microsoft mouse, keyboard and Samsung monitor to complete the system. Including Windows 7 (see below), the PC cost me about $1400 plus tax. Now it was my turn to get busy with my new machine. BIOS Tweaks When you get a new PC, it’s a good idea to check BIOS settings to make sure BIOS is optimized for audio processing. Always make a backup of your BIOS first. Or, at minimum, take a digital photo or a screengrab of each screen so you can recreate the original settings if needed. In this case, there were some settings I wanted to disable. Turbo Boost – Disabled. Turbo Boost is an Intel feature that kicks up the processing speed on demand when the operating system requests more speed. This concept is also called “dynamic overclocking”. Like other types of overclocking, it has been shown to interfere with audio processing for some DAW software. CPU Enhanced Halt (C1E), CPU EIST (ie. Speedstep) based, C3/C6/C7 – All Disabled. Power Management features like these should be disabled, as they have a way of causing glitches in the middle of your audio operations. I’m all for being green, but not when it crashes your audio projects.

Upgrade #2 – Windows
As a happy Windows XP Pro user for almost ten years (!), I viewed Windows 7 64-bit Pro with a mix of hope and fear. Most of the old XP features are still there, if some are in a new location. The user interface looks cooler, startup and shutdown are faster, and it’s 64-bit! There’s a lot to like in Windows 7!

To go with the new 64-bit operating sytem, I also needed a 64-bit Antivirus/Antispyware package. I canvassed several DAW user forums to research current products and how they work with various DAW software. Based on that, I decided to try the free Microsoft Security Essentials, and so far it’s working very well. It’s fast, reliable, and has a small footprint that doesn’t interfere with my music workflow. I hope they don’t change it! In the past I’ve used Norton, AVG and PC Tools products for a few years each. But I had to move on as each one eventually grew to a larger footprint that caused dropouts during my recording and playback operations.
